Ügyészség refers to a branch of the law enforcement and prosecution system in certain countries, particularly in Hungary. It is responsible for conducting investigations and prosecutions in accordance with the laws and regulations of the country. The ügyészség is an autonomous institution that operates separately from the judicial branch and is often headed by a high-ranking official.
The main tasks of the ügyészség include investigating crimes, preparing evidence, and conducting prosecutions in courts
